微信小程序|小程序开发
小程序,元素,循环
微信小程序-小程序开发微信小程序获取循环元素id以及wx.login登录操作
微信导航asp源码,vscode gitlab插件,ubuntu21.04新功能,怎么配置 tomcat,sqlite查询语句出错,lscroll插件,电商前端ui框架,爬虫采集api接口,php 文本框的值,seo软件代理seo公司,大灌篮网站源码,flash xml网页模板,排行榜模板,dede怎么调整页面大小,asp固定资产管理系统,二手小程序源码前端后端lzw
通过点击方法获取循环数据元素的id例:
一元云购app开发源码,怎么重建ubuntu引导,选品数据爬虫,php pptx,金融seo营销lzw
wxml里:
进销存系统 php源码,ubuntu如何删除路径,tomcat8加入服务,scrapyd管理爬虫,卢比换php,网络推广seo用兴田德润lzw
{{item.name}} ¥{{item.price}}/{{item.unit}} {{item.place}} (数据更新时间:{{item.date}}) 肉产类
上面的a标签的id是通过循环来的,js能通过catchtap=”gotoresult”来获取当前点击的元素idjs里:
gotoresult:function(e){ var ep = e.target.id console.log(ep); }
小程序用户登录wx.login操作
js里:
wx.login({ success: function (res) { if (res.code) {//发起网络请求wx.request({url: https://api./sns/jscode2session,//url: https://www.xxx你的服务器网站/,data: { appid:"你的appid", secret: "获取的secret", js_code: res.code, grant_type:"authorization_code"},success:function(res){ message=res.data; console.log(message.openid)//返回的res里有用户openid等私密信息}}) } else {console.log(获取用户登录态失败! + res.errMsg)//异常反馈 } } });
通过以上方式,可以向微信发送请求获取传回来的openid等信息;
小程序通过wx.checkSession可以判断登录是否过期
js里:
wx.checkSession({ success: function(){ //session 未过期,并且在本生命周期一直有效 }, fail: function(){ //登录态过期 wx.login() //重新登录 .... }})
如果登录过期,就可以调用上面的we.login来进行登录